Marseille Duo Wanted By Irons

Having today finally announced the long awaited news that Slaven Billic was to take over as manager of West Ham, it seems that he and the board will be wasting little time in bringing in fresh bodies ahead of the new campaign.

The Mirror reports that there are 3 main targets that the club are pressing hard to bring to the East End. The first of these is the Spanish defensive midfielder Pedro Obiang from Sampdoria, who has signed for the club for a reported €6m. He is a defensive midfielder who is hoped to fill the gap left by the departure of Alex Song, following his loan’s expiration.

Also reported to be high on the Hammers’ wanted list are the Marseille pair Andre-Pierre Gignac and Andre Ayew. Ayew, the highly rated winger is said to be host to many offers at the moment. Having reportedly turned down an offer from AS Roma, Ayew is said to be keen on a move to the Premier League. According to BBC Sport, the Ghanaian international was in Swansea today to hold talks over a possible move to the Welsh club, but West Ham are keen to sign him and are willing to offer him £70,000 a week to secure him.

The battle to sign Gignac is also said to be a very busy one too, with West Brom having supposedly offered him a ‘huge contract offer’. However there is still interest from the Hammers along with other teams like Southampton, Stoke and Newcastle, all keen to sign the profilic French target man.
